The Pricing Shared Services team owns the core set of systems which decides prices of products sold by Amazon Retail. The team owns system data vending, notification and price publishing systems which are used by multiple pricing strategy teams for building their price recommendation and submission of their recommended prices. These systems scale to thousands of TPS and computes prices for billions of listings every month. We are building new services that radically scale the publishing capacity of our systems while making our services multi-tenant to support Amazon's growing number of businesses. We collaborate with product, science, and business teams to figure out new ideas. We innovate by applying state-of-the-art computer science to define, design, and build our systems. We experiment with different approaches, eager to learn from whatever the results are while having fun along the way.

As a Software Development Engineer, you will develop services using your expertise and experience with a variety of technologies. You will deep-dive into distributed systems to design and optimize for performance, maintainability, scalability, and extensibility. You will innovate and scale services, addressing problems that span new feature development to new system creation. You will design and write clean, maintainable code and integrate data from a large number of services. You will contribute to the development of yourself and colleagues through peer code-reviews and mentoring, improving the technical knowledge and engineering practices of your team.
- 3+ years of non-internship professional software development experience
- 2+ years of non-internship design or architecture (design patterns, reliability and scaling) of new and existing systems experience
- Experience programming with at least one software programming language
- 3+ years of full software development life cycle, including coding standards, code reviews, source control management, build processes, testing, and operations experience
- Bachelor's degree in computer science or equivalent

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several US geographic markets. The base pay for this position ranges from $129,300/year in our lowest geographic market up to $223,600/year in our highest geographic market.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. Amazon is a total compensation company. Dependent on the position offered, equity, sign-on payments, and other forms of compensation may be provided as part of a total compensation package, in addition to a full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its.
